Description:

Hunt Sitka Blacktail on the vessel based transport hunt of a lifetime.  Departing Kodiak Alaska every Thursday, mid October thru early December.  We depart on seven day vessel based Sitka Blacktail Deer hunts across the entire Kodiak Archipeligo.  The Kodiak Archipeligo is home to vast numbers of Sitka Blacktail deer, being aboard our floating base camp, which allows easy access to hundreds of miles of coastline not accessible by traditional drop-off hunting, or other operations that “homestead” the same hunting grounds year after year.

Accommodations:

A 60′ yacht Powered by twin diesels it is both safe and reliable, with a cruising range of nearly three thousand miles. State of the art safety equipment includes, self inflating life rafts, EPIRB, sat phone, dual VHF’s, dual GPS chart plotters, radar, and a fixed firefighting unit in the engine room. Measuring sixty five feet with a beam of nearly twenty feet the Venturess is also the largest and most comfortable long range vessel in the fleet. Wide walk around decks, a fully covered aft deck to get out of inclement weather, and a five ton fish hold make the Venturess the ultimate long range Sport fisher. Cabin amenities include bunk space for 12 with ample storage and outlets. Two heads (marine toilets), one shower with attached changing room/sink combo.

How to get there:

Fly into Kodiak via Anchorage on Alaska Air, arrives at 4:30pm (overnight in Anchorage may be required) depart lodge at 8am on departure day

Tags/License

Non Res Annual hunting license and 7 day sport fishing license $230  Non Res 7 day King Salmon stamp $45 State waterfowl stamp $10 Deer tag $300
